Summary
Holocaust Victims' Assets, Restitution Policy, and Remembrance Act - Establishes the National Foundation for the Study of Holocaust Assets as an independent entity of the Executive branch to: (1) serve as a centralized repository for research and information about Holocaust-era assets; and (2) create tools to assist individuals and institutions to determine the ownership of Holocaust victims' assets and to enable claimants to obtain the speedy resolution of their personal property claims.
